Output 26ef81f302241ec2c06533069dfc4860718db2250c7585013a9d66d3fbc255f6:9

value
42000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22322866743b8fd97121a314842674d6ce05ac29 OP_EQUAL
address
34opz6Hb5WPqNqhnWREvGhkv5PqXwFpVNP
transaction
26ef81f302241ec2c06533069dfc4860718db2250c7585013a9d66d3fbc255f6
confirmations
66129
spent
true